The current director general of the airline replaces Jesús Nuño de la Rosa as head of management

Bet on internal promotion and recognition of the years of management of Air Europa. The airline’s current general manager, Richard Clark, has been appointed CEO, replacing Jesús Nuño de la Rosa, who has held the role since the summer of 2022 on behalf of SEPI. The new manager who will support President Juan José Hidalgo at the helm of the company joined its ranks in 1987 and has led strategic areas and projects of the utmost importance.
